About Noto Sans Hanunoo

Noto Sans Hanunoo provides coverage for the Hanunoo script, an ancient Philippine abugida traditionally used by the Mangyan people of Mindoro island. Designed as part of the Noto project's mission to eliminate tofu across all Unicode scripts, it maintains the upright, rhythmic strokes characteristic of indigenous Philippine writing. An essential resource for linguistic preservation, academic research, and cultural documentation projects.
